1. TODAY is mourning the loss of a family member: The anchors remembered Jim Lovell, an audio technician and father of four who died in Sunday’s train crash in New York City.

"Everybody loved him," said Al. “He always had a smile and a kind word," added Natalie.

2. Al, Willie and Carson said goodbye to their No-Shave November beards, and transformed their faces into stubbly works of art – thanks to your help.

Fans voted for goatees for Al and Carson and a mustache for Willie. (Matt elected to keep his beard!) Whose new (facial) ‘do do you like best?

3. When 4-year-old Noah Fisher found out he’d have to wear glasses to school, he burst into tears.

His mom took to Facebook, and asked friends to show Noah just how awesome glasses can be. The response, as his parents pointed out this morning, was wonderful.
